"Damili" is a word in ILOKANO, HILIGAYNON, CEBUANO
n. earthenware. v. /AG-/ to make this. /MANG-:-EN/ to make as earthenware.

damili a dirty and sticky.
v [B; b6] get, become dirty.
Nagdamili ang lamísa kay gitrapúhan ug húgaw, The table is sticky because it was wiped with a dirty cloth.
